Output 592bca63bb0d73fa09f8c128c490262478943dd0dcf02dc5f9d0a02bbae4058a:0

value
9100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66e78806e6aea597fa7a70901c8275aadd9ad1d OP_EQUAL
address
3MEpsEaagqw87cwMnqprvprdhttvc7NRmc
transaction
592bca63bb0d73fa09f8c128c490262478943dd0dcf02dc5f9d0a02bbae4058a
spent
true